Startup Roundup – 2nd August

Social Discovery Insights is constantly on the lookout for new players, disruptive business models, and innovative technologies, in the social discovery market.

  1. Entice Community empowers artists by offering a single platform to share work, find jobs, sell products, and get inspired. Users can connect through community posts, build their portfolios, and discover job opportunities, making it a hub for creative professionals.
  2. How We Feel is a science-based app to help users understand and manage their emotions, and share them with friends and loved ones. Developed with Yale’s Center for Emotional Intelligence, it tracks mood patterns and provides video strategies for emotional regulation, to help improve mental and social wellbeing.
  3. Cantina invites users to a private network where they can interact with personality-driven AI bots in live community spaces. This creative social app allows friends to engage with bots, create their own, and explore new spaces together, offering a unique blend of human and AI interaction.

In Case You Missed It! Here’s last week’s Startup Roundup:

  1. Literal Club facilitates how readers discover, organize, and discuss books. Users can build personal libraries, track reading habits, and share impactful highlights with friends, offering a social twist on literary exploration.
  2. Meet5 is the top leisure app in Germany, Austria, and Switzerland for group meet-ups. It facilitates connections through activities and events, allowing users to make new friends based on shared interests and favourite activities.
  3. StayCircles makes travel affordable and social by connecting friends and friends-of-friends for free lodging. Users can plan trips, share flight deals, and stay with someone from their social circles, dramatically reducing travel costs and enhancing the travel experience.
